Featured dishes

View full menu
Mutton Rolls (2)
Boneless pieces of mutton cooked with potato and seasoned with jaffna spices (curry powder, curry leaves, ginger & garlic), rolled in filo pastry and lightly coated with breadcrumbs. Served with a side salad.
Vegetable Rolls (2)
Fresh carrot, cabbage & leeks cooked with potato, seasoned with crushed black pepper, rolled in filo pastry, lightly coated with breadcrumbs and served with a side salad. (V)
Fish Cutlets (2)
The most popular sri lankan "short eat", crispy croquettes with spicy mackerel & potato fillings.
Vegetable Samosa (2)
Vegetable filled deep fried crispy snack. (V)

visited laya a few times since moving down to hastings. a beautifully located restaurant with views of the promenade and horizon. everything on the menu is fairly priced and delicious. our favourites include the kothu roti (mutton). although the server offered a mild spice option, i did find this to be a bit spicier than i would’ve liked, but i would consider my tolerance quite low. for those with a higher tolerance, you’ll definitely enjoy this even more ! staff are always very friendly. on our first visit here, we were a table of 12 for dinner and food was served quite quickly, the second time, we were a table of 3 for lunch and the service was a little slower, though it seems there’s not a lot of staff in the kitchen so dishes may take a little longer to come out. for us, it was roughly 25-30 minutes. however, the food was still delicious and well worth the wait. definitely worth stopping by for a visit can be difficult to find street parking in the area, but crystal square car park is nearby which usually has plenty of space in the evenings, but quite busy in the afternoon

Been dining here since 2023. Highly recommended to those who are craving authentic South Indian and Sri Lankan cuisine. From the moment you walk in, you’re greeted with a warm smile by the couple who runs this place and inviting atmosphere that sets the tone for a delightful dining experience. The menu is packed with a variety of traditional dishes, each bursting with flavors that transport you straight to the heart of South India and Sri Lanka. The service is attentive and friendly, adding to the overall positive experience. Presentation of dishes are as pleasing and top notch as they taste. Each dish is crafted with care and authenticity, making it clear that the chefs are passionate about their craft. In short, this restaurant serves not just a meal but a taste of culture and tradition, and it’s definitely worth a visit for anyone looking to indulge in delicious, authentic food. Always a good time place to get back.

What a great restaurant! My wife wanted to go to Laya for her birthday in search of something a bit different. The place has a relaxed café vibe, we received a warm welcome and attentive service throughout our evening. I did however sense that we missed out on being served by the gent who looked to be the owner, as he spent time to talk other diners through the menu and looked to be making expert recommendations. However, we had a pretty good idea what we were ordering and everything that we ate was absolutely spectacular. Beautifully cooked, delicious and fresh Sri Lankan food that really tickled the taste-buds. It was great to spot that there were so many locals in the restaurant, always a sign of a decent place. We’ll be back soon and next time I’ll ask for the spiciness to be turned up and want to try the Lion beer that comes so recommended by other diners!
